Apple iTunes could offer video rentals
In future, Apple Inc. will offer video rentals through iTunes. Apple Inc. has already started talks with some big moviescompanies regarding the launch of online film rental services. Currently, Apple has two deals with Walt Disney and Paramount. Online rental is another source to generate more revenues without affecting sales.
A film would likely to cost $2.99 and users are allowed to keep it for 30 days. This would be a competition towards cable companies. To avoid piracy, users are allowed to copy the movie to a device only, computer or iPod.
